Assistant Quartermaster's Office, Depot of Washington, No. 151 G Street, near 21st, Washington, D.C. Sept 4th, 1866. Bvt. Major J. M. Brown, Asst. Quartermaster, Washington, DC. Major: It is reported, that certain parties are committing considerable depredations on buildings on the corner of 24th and F Sts, recently turned over to your Bureau. I am directed by the chief Depot Quartermaster, to suggest, that steps be taken, to properly guard said buildings. I am Major, Very Respectfy Your obdt Servt., Jas M Moore Bvt Lt Col and Asst. Qr. Mr. U.S. Army.
